Luke Hart: Rubber Bookshelf

Shelves, in part, are meant for organizing. But don’t you ever just casually throw, pile, and stack you books your bookshelf?
This Rubber Bookcase designed by Luke Hart makes one very much aware of how and where to display books on a shelf. The rubber material gives and bows with the weight of a book. Because there are no side walls, you must have a tall book that stretches past between the layers of rubber to create tension and stability in order to put shorter book. In addition, the shelves mold and transform in shape with certain book which causes you to consider the best possible areas to place other books on neighboring shelves.
